Libre Barcode:告别专业软件依赖的字体化条码生成方案
价值定位:重新定义条码生成的便捷性边界
在零售管理系统中,一位店员正为无法快速生成商品条码而发愁——专业软件昂贵且操作复杂,在线工具受网络限制且存在数据安全风险。这正是无数中小企业和个人用户面临的共同困境:条码生成的技术门槛与使用成本之间的矛盾。
Libre Barcode项目通过创新的字体化设计,将条码生成转化为简单的文本输入操作。用户只需安装字体文件,即可在任何文字处理软件中直接创建符合国际标准的可扫描条码。这种"即装即用"的解决方案,彻底消除了传统条码生成流程中的技术壁垒。
核心优势:四大突破重构用户体验
零成本实施的专业级解决方案
- 无许可费用:基于OFL开源许可证,个人与商业使用完全免费
- 硬件无关性:无需专用设备,普通打印机即可输出可扫描条码
- 维护零负担:字体文件一次安装,终身使用,无需频繁更新
三种主流条码标准全覆盖
- Code 39系列:支持字母数字混合编码,适用于资产管理与物流追踪
- Code 128系列:高密度编码格式,满足小空间内存储大量信息的需求
- EAN 13系列:国际通用商品条码标准,支持零售系统全面集成
智能校验位计算系统
输入12位数字后使用"?"作为占位符,字体将自动计算并生成第13位校验码。这一功能大幅降低了人工计算错误率,确保条码符合国际扫描标准。
多环境兼容设计
无论是专业排版软件还是基础文本编辑器,Libre Barcode均能稳定工作。针对不同OpenType支持程度的软件环境,提供标准输入、备用编码和Grandzebu兼容三种模式。
场景实践:从常规应用到创新解决方案
决策树:选择最适合你的条码方案
零售商品场景
- 需要13位商品条码 → EAN 13 Text字体
- 输入示例:
690123456789?(自动计算校验位) - 适用软件:Word/Excel/标签打印软件
仓储管理场景
- 需要字母数字混合编码 → Code 39 Extended
- 包含文本显示需求 → Code 39 Text字体
- 纯条码需求 → Code 39 Regular字体
文档追踪场景
- 高密度信息编码需求 → Code 128字体
- 需同时显示编码文本 → Code 128 Text字体
边缘应用场景拓展
图书馆藏书管理 使用Code 39 Extended字体为每本书生成包含馆号、分类号和ISBN的复合条码,实现一书一码的精准管理。配合普通激光打印机制作标签,成本仅为专业方案的1/20。
医疗样本追踪 在病理样本容器上使用Code 128字体生成唯一标识条码,兼容医院现有扫描系统。字体的高识别率特性确保样本信息在整个检验流程中的准确传递。
技术解析:字体里的智能编码系统
创新的OpenType功能实现
Libre Barcode采用"上下文替代"(Contextual Alternates)技术,将普通数字字符映射为复杂的条码图形。这种设计类似于"智能输入法",用户输入简单数字,系统自动转换为专业条码符号。
通俗类比:就像在手机上输入":) "会自动转换为😊表情,Libre Barcode将"123456"转换为对应的条码图形,而原始数字仍保留在文档中,支持搜索和编辑。
条码生成流程解析
- 用户输入数字序列(如"01234567890?")
- 字体引擎识别数字模式并激活相应编码规则
- 自动计算校验位(当输入"?"占位符时)
- 渲染完整条码图形,包含必要的起始/终止符和数据符
与传统方案的对比优势
| 特性 | Libre Barcode | 专业条码软件 | 在线生成工具 |
|---|---|---|---|
| 成本 | 完全免费 | 数百至数千元 | 按次收费或订阅制 |
| 依赖 | 仅需字体支持 | 专用软件安装 | 网络连接和服务商 |
| 数据安全 | 本地处理,无数据泄露 | 本地处理 | 数据上传至第三方 |
| 灵活性 | 任何文字处理软件 | 专用界面操作 | 受限于网站功能 |
| 离线使用 | 完全支持 | 支持 | 不支持 |
项目演进路线:未来功能展望
短期规划(6个月内)
- 新增UPC-A和UPC-E条码格式支持
- 开发条码质量检测工具,帮助用户验证打印效果
- 提供更多语言的使用文档和示例模板
中期目标(1-2年)
- 实现二维条码(如QR Code)的字体化支持
- 开发批量生成工具,支持CSV数据导入
- 建立在线社区,分享行业应用案例和最佳实践
注意事项与常见误区
- 分辨率要求:打印条码时分辨率至少300dpi,否则可能无法扫描
- 缩放问题:条码应保持原始比例缩放,拉伸变形会导致识别失败
- 校验位使用:EAN 13条码必须包含校验位,使用"?"占位符自动生成
- 字体选择:Text版本包含人类可读文本,纯条码版本更节省空间
Libre Barcode通过将复杂的条码生成技术封装为简单的字体文件,为各行业用户提供了前所未有的便捷解决方案。无论是小型零售商还是大型企业,都能以零成本实现专业级条码管理。随着项目的持续演进,这一创新方案将在更多领域展现其价值。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



